WebDuring the operation, two operatives sank the flagship of the Greenpeace fleet, the Rainbow Warrior in the port of Auckland, New Zealand. The French government wanted to prevent the ship from interfering with a planned nuclear test in Moruroa . Fernando Pereira, a photographer, drowned on the sinking ship. WebThe French government sank the Rainbow Warrior on 10 July 1985, using underwater explosives. The Greenpeace ship was moored in Auckland, New Zealand, with plans to confront French nuclear testing in the Moruroa Atoll. In an effort to sabotage the protest, French secret service agents attached two bombs to the side of the ship below the …
